Architecture of Observation Towers

It seems to be human nature to enjoy a view, getting the higher ground and taking in our surroundings has become a significant aspect of architecture across the world. Observation towers which allow visitors to climb and observe their surroundings, provide a chance to take in the beauty of the land while at the same time adding something unique and impressive to the landscape.

5. Clearview Pioneer 400

The Pioneer 400 is Clearview's highest specifications small stove ever constructed. It is extremely efficient in terms of fuel consumption - burning just one kilo every hour, will remain in the home for a night and even boil a kettle (and heat your water, if you select the optional boiler). This robust 5kW stove is equally at home in rural cottages, modern apartment buildings or mobile homes.

The Clearview Pioneer 400 has a heavy steel construction that is made of welded outside and inside. It also features a refractory liner which promotes an extremely clean combustion. This makes the stove highly efficient and able to produce up 5kW in your space and more than many cast iron stoves.

All wear and tear parts of the stove are easily replaced, making maintenance comparatively effortless. The ash pan made of stainless steel is designed to make cleaning easy, with adjustable hinges and door catch to ensure an airtight seal throughout the life of the stove. The Pioneer 400 also offers adjustable levelling bolts on the base, allowing you to compensate for uneven hearths. It also comes with the hot plate to take your coffee pot or kettle.

The Pioneer 400 is approved for use in DEFRA areas for smoke control and can be fitted with an optional boiler or multi-fuel grates that can accommodate other solid fuels such as peat.
